Abstract

The present invention relates to pressure stabilizing mechanism and to a hydraulic pump including the pressure stabilizing mechanism. The pressure stabilizing mechanism comprises a frame, a piston and a first and second seals. The frame defines a piston chamber, a lower-pressure circuit and a higher-pressure inlet. The piston chamber has a first section of smaller circumference and a second section of larger circumference. The first section of the piston chamber connects the lower-pressure circuit and the higher-pressure inlet. The lower-pressure circuit further connects with the second section of the piston chamber. The lower-pressure circuit receives a fluid at a lower pressure and the higher-pressure inlet receives the fluid at a higher pressure. The piston is slidably movable in the piston chamber between an open position and a closed position. The piston slidably moves between the closed and open position upon relative variation between the lower-pressure fluid and larger surface in the second chamber with respect to the higher-pressure fluid and smaller surface in the first chamber of the piston chamber.
